Summary
The Physician Assistant (PA) is a licensed medical professional who practices medicine in collaboration with physicians and other care team members. The PA evaluates, diagnoses, and manages patient health concerns across the lifespan, provides preventive services, and coordinates care to promote optimal health outcomes.Job Description
Perform patient assessments, including medical histories and physical examinations. Diagnose and manage acute and chronic conditions within scope of practice. Order, review, and interpret diagnostic tests and imaging studies. Prescribe medications, therapies, and other treatments in compliance with regulations. Educate and counsel patients and families on health maintenance, disease prevention, and treatment plans. May perform procedures & treatments within scope of practice & assist with procedures & treatments when indicated. Collaborate with interdisciplinary team members to ensure continuity of care. Maintain accurate, timely, and thorough documentation in the electronic medical record (EMR). Participate in quality, safety, and performance improvement activities.Qualifications
Completion of a Physician Assistant program accredited by the ARC-PA or equivalent accrediting program accepted by the state licensing board.Clinical experience in specialty area is preferred but not required.
Current licensure as a Physician Assistant in each state of practice. Current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) permit to prescribe controlled substances in each state of practice. State Controlled Substance License (if required by State) Current certification by the National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ants (NCCPA).
